Impact of Steam on Water Transport

3 across Articles in this Category: click a link

Nobby Waterman, The

bar279: Dates 1837~1840|

A Watermen is swept out of his boat by the wash from steamboat and drowned. [279Synopsis]

Newcastle And Shields Railway

bar273c: Dates 1839~1839|

A Tyne river pilot anticipates the impact of steam boats and railways.

Excursion to Putney

bar112: Dates 1840~1844|

Pleasure seekers rowing on the Thames and are run aground by the wash from a steam boat. [112Synopsis]

Keelmen o' the Tyne

bar539: Dates 1841~1849|

A keelman asserts that keel boats can get the better of steam boats/railways.

New Sang Tiv an Aad Teun

bar648: Dates ----~1879|

The narrator comments on the changes wrought by steam boats and laments that his son has gone to sea on a steam vessel. 

State of Great Britain

bar399: Dates 1834~1841|

Lament for hard times including verses on the hardship caused by railroads and steamboats

Steam Jobbing versus Greenwich Watermen

bar679: Dates 1819~1824|

The Watermen's objection to the establishment of a Steamer Company [679Synopsis]
